The CIO for private wealth management at Chinese investment group Haitong International (Haitong) has resigned, people familiar with the matter told Asian Private Banker. Hyde Chen joined the securities and asset management firm in November 2021, initially as managing director, head of investment strategy and co-head of equities for asset management.
